About The Position

At Medtronic, we bring bold ideas forward with speed and decisiveness to put patients first in everything we do. In-person exchanges are invaluable to our work. We’re working a minimum of 4 days a week onsite as part of our commitment to fostering a culture of professional growth and cross-functional collaboration as we work together to engineer the extraordinary. Reporting to the Sr Director of Strategic Alliances Commercialization, this individual contributor is responsible for supporting commercial execution and strategy between Medtronic and our Strategic Alliance partners, with an eye to growth opportunities. A successful candidate will support developing, driving and executing on partnership initiatives, including supporting product launches, supporting regional key initiatives, supporting partner promotions, and executing on programs and initiatives that help to further differentiate our brand, position, and messaging. This role will help to provide solutions to support customer needs and business growth goals by leading and executing on effective plans and programs, both strategic and tactical, to ensure we achieve both market share gains and increase penetration of our technology. The candidate will be expected to independently develop and implement programs and/or initiatives aligned to the strategy, which will require a high degree of cross-functional interaction and leadership capability. These programs and/or initiatives will also need alignment towards identified strategic partners, where a mutual benefit enables both companies to grow share/revenue. To be successful in this role, the candidate will build successful partnerships with the regions, strategic partners, field sales forces and cross-functional partners to inform strategies and will be seen as a driver of our commercial strategies, often utilizing our partner’s channel. This position has a unique vantage point, collaborating across global & regional functions, primarily focused on enabling ACM growth through partnership channels. Travel approximately 30% (domestic and international). This critical role uses strategic thinking to actively participate in decision analysis using internal and external data, problem formulation, meeting facilitation, data collection, model development and implementation and presentations to senior leadership.
